Torquay Reef Point - Torquay, Australia
Torquay Reef Point features a rocky reef break with a flat rock bottom, ideal for experienced surfers. The waves break both right and left, delivering powerful, hollow, and fast conditions. Best surfed at high tide, the spot can become too shallow at low tide, risking damage to equipment.
This location offers instant access from the cliff, making it convenient for surfers. While the area is generally empty during the week, expect a few surfers on weekends. The surrounding environment includes rips and undertow, so caution is advised. Unlike the more beginner-friendly Torquay Backbeach, which attracts crowds, Torquay Reef Point remains a hidden gem for those seeking challenging waves. On good days, it can produce some of the best and longest barrels, making it a must-visit for confident surfers looking for an exhilarating experience.
